Terms Used In Indiana Code > Title 5 > Article 22 > Chapter 6.5 - Contracts for Collection Services

  • Contract: A legal written agreement that becomes binding when signed.
  • person: means an individual, an incorporated or unincorporated organization or association, the state, a unit of local government, an agency of the state or a unit of local government, or a group of such persons acting in concert. See Indiana Code 5-22-6.5-1
  • service: means an action or actions to be performed under authority of the state, a state agency, a body corporate and politic, a state university, a unit of local government, or an agency of a unit of local government permitted by law to be done by its chief officer or governing or legislative body for the convenience or necessity of its citizens, but not including any action that constitutes the exercise of its discretionary powers, an exercise of state sovereignty, or the taking of legislative, quasi-legislative, judicial, or quasi-judicial action. See Indiana Code 5-22-6.5-2
